**14:22** — Harrowfield notification fan-out began queuing faster than workers drained it; backpressure tripped the Lintervale circuit breaker and delayed push delivery by up to nine minutes. Support saw "stuck notification" reports spike here. On-call throttled the fan-out multiplier to 0.5x, which stabilized the queue. The trace token captured at this moment appears below.

build token for yajof-bajof: htk31_506ff1188f74596b5bb2eec94edc43c

## Onboarding: Markprint Pipeline

Markprint converts docs-repo markdown into the Velutra customer portal. Renderer runs in CI; output bundles are immutable once tagged. Release manager duties: cut the weekly tag, verify the HTML diff report, approve the bundle promotion. Do not hand-edit rendered output — fix source and re-run. Broken links block promotion automatically. Promotion requires the bundle to be signed before upload. Sign with the current release key, shown below.

release key, hadug-kawef: bky13_mPGeFZeR1GZ1G

**Checklist item 7 — Catalogue import verification.** Before signing off on a Shelfwright import run, confirm that the record count in the staging table matches the source manifest from the Marrowdale Library feed, that duplicate ISBN-style identifiers were merged rather than dropped, and that the rollback snapshot completed. New team members: do not approve runs with more than 0.5% rejected rows; flag them instead. Final approval for each import batch rests with:

named custodian: Belius Casath Ulaix Sorius

## Runbook: Tidemark widget — key rotation

Scope: tide-table prediction widget served by the Shorely gateway. Rotate signing keys quarterly. The widget caches station data for 24h; stale cache after rotation is expected, not an incident. Verify upstream feed checksum before re-enabling writes. Audit logging must stay on in all environments. Current production configuration is listed below.

deployment values, kajep-kageg:
[praix]
host = praix.paliqcorp.corp
user = praix_svc
database = praix_prod